Output 51b886bc737151c14dc6891f09077e8cfab7e06312caaaddbafa2966cc282946:0

value
37073020
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 66c2df5a3f435697b089711b03e1fb39a1242228 OP_EQUALVERIFY OP_CHECKSIG
address
FeY4pTFBzTaQjms83LhysLhsafYuyQ3nD3
transaction
51b886bc737151c14dc6891f09077e8cfab7e06312caaaddbafa2966cc282946